The Core Components of a Small Business Branding Package

A small business branding package consists of several essential elements that define a brand’s identity. The logo serves as the visual cornerstone, providing instant recognition and setting the tone for the brand. It should be versatile, scalable, and memorable. Alongside the logo, a consistent color palette ensures visual coherence across all marketing materials, reinforcing brand recognition. Typography also plays a crucial role, as the right fonts can enhance readability and convey the brand’s personality.

Beyond visuals, a strong brand package includes a unique value proposition that differentiates the business from competitors. This messaging should be concise, clear, and aligned with the brand’s mission. A well-defined brand voice establishes consistency in communication, making marketing efforts more effective. Whether a brand is playful, professional, or innovative, maintaining a consistent tone across social media, websites, and customer interactions is essential.

Creating a Cohesive Brand Identity

For a small business, a cohesive brand identity ensures that customers instantly recognize and connect with the brand. This starts with developing a compelling brand story that reflects the company’s values, mission, and goals. A strong narrative helps customers relate to the brand on a personal level, fostering emotional engagement.

Consistency in branding is another vital factor. From packaging and business cards to social media posts and advertisements, all materials should align with the brand’s established guidelines. Maintaining uniformity builds credibility and reinforces brand recognition, making it easier for customers to remember and trust the business.

The Role of Digital Presence in Branding

In the modern era, an online presence is indispensable for small businesses. A well-designed website is the foundation of digital branding, providing a professional and accessible platform for potential customers. The website should reflect the brand’s aesthetic and voice while offering an intuitive user experience. High-quality visuals, engaging copy, and seamless navigation contribute to a positive impression and encourage visitors to explore further.

Social media is another powerful tool for branding. Platforms such as Instagram, Facebook, LinkedIn, and Twitter allow businesses to showcase their personality, interact with customers, and build brand awareness. A small business branding package should include strategies for content creation, audience engagement, and platform-specific optimization. Posting consistently, responding to comments, and utilizing visual storytelling help create a strong brand presence online.

The Importance of Brand Differentiation

With countless businesses competing for attention, differentiation is key to success. A branding package should highlight what makes the business unique, whether it’s exceptional customer service, innovative products, or a commitment to sustainability. Crafting a unique selling proposition (USP) helps businesses position themselves effectively in the market.

Another way to stand out is through brand personality. Humanizing the brand by incorporating authentic storytelling, humor, or relatability can create a more meaningful connection with customers. Personal touches such as behind-the-scenes content, employee highlights, or customer testimonials add depth to the brand’s identity, making it more relatable and engaging.

Maintaining Brand Consistency Across All Channels

Brand consistency is essential for long-term success. Every touchpoint, from emails to packaging, should reflect the brand’s established identity. Clear brand guidelines outlining logo usage, color schemes, fonts, and tone of voice help ensure consistency across different platforms and materials.

Training employees on brand standards also plays a role in maintaining uniformity. Whether interacting with customers in-store, responding to inquiries online, or posting on social media, team members should represent the brand in a way that aligns with its values and personality. A unified approach strengthens brand recognition and fosters customer trust.

Adapting and Evolving Your Brand

While consistency is vital, brands should also remain adaptable to stay relevant. Trends, customer preferences, and market conditions evolve over time, and businesses must be willing to refine their branding accordingly. Regularly assessing branding strategies, gathering customer feedback, and staying informed about industry shifts allow businesses to make necessary adjustments without losing their core identity.

Rebranding is sometimes necessary when expanding services, targeting new demographics, or updating outdated visuals. A strategic approach ensures that any changes align with the existing brand while enhancing its appeal. Subtle refinements, rather than drastic overhauls, help maintain familiarity while keeping the brand fresh and engaging.
